What is Bacillus megaterium?

Bacillus megaterium is a gram-positive bacterium that is part of the genus Bacillus. This particular bacterium can form spores and produce potassium-fixing and phosphate-fixing fertilizers, specifically exampling efficacy in degrading organic phosphorus within the soil. B. megaterium is known for its ability to improve soil's micro-ecological environment, which enables dominant bacterial flora found within the soil to maintain a dominant position. Additionally, B. megaterium also reduces disease and residue from pesticides. Once it is applied to the soil, it then begins to multiply, making it the dominant bacteria, allowing it to control the resources and nutrition within the rhizosphere. The bacterium also thickens cell walls, fibrosis, and lignification of the plant's relevant tissue. It forms a horny double silicon layer outside the epidermal layer to form a barrier to prevent the invasion of pathogens.
